The significance of Leaves From the Vine makes it much more emotional to hear it. The voice actor for Iroh, Mako Iwamatsu, had throat cancer and died before finishing his work on the show. Singing this song was actually hurting him, physically and emotionally, knowing his time was coming to an end. It’s said that people outside the recording booth were crying while he sang. The new voice actor for Iroh in book 3 said he’s often asked to sing leaves from the vine at fan conventions but always denies, saying it’s Mako’s song. In the Legend of Korra, the sequel series to The Last Airbender, one of the main characters is a fire bender named Mako, after Irohs voice actor.
